A Global Certificate Course in Business Cultural Intelligence equips participants with the crucial skills to navigate the complexities of international business. This program fosters a deep understanding of cultural nuances and their impact on business practices, negotiations, and team dynamics.
Learning outcomes include enhanced cross-cultural communication, improved conflict resolution strategies within diverse teams, and the ability to adapt leadership styles to different cultural contexts. Participants will develop practical frameworks for understanding cultural differences and leveraging them for successful business outcomes. This involves developing strong intercultural competence.
The duration of the Global Certificate Course in Business Cultural Intelligence varies depending on the provider, but typically ranges from a few weeks to several months of part-time study. Many programs offer flexible online learning options, catering to busy professionals.

A Global Certificate Course in Business Cultural Intelligence is increasingly significant in today's interconnected market. The UK's reliance on international trade highlights this need. According to a recent survey by the British Chambers of Commerce, 70% of UK businesses export goods or services, making cross-cultural understanding crucial for success. This necessitates professionals with strong cultural intelligence skills to navigate diverse markets and build effective international relationships. The course equips learners with practical frameworks to understand and adapt to various cultural nuances, fostering better communication and collaboration.
